Cleaning the pump inside with water
CAUTION
After cleaning the inside of chemical tank, pour water into the tank again, run the pump, and clean the
pump inside and the nozzles until the sprayed mist of chemical solution is completely replaced with
clean water.
Leaving the pump inside without it being water-cleaned will cause failure of the pump and nozzles.

Water draining
–
Do not fail to drain the tank. Otherwise the freezing of water may damage the pump in winter.
–
After draining the chemical tank, grip the grip lever to run the pump without load as far as the remaining
water in the tank is completely discharged. Never continue the no-load run of the pump for longer than 1
minute. Otherwise the pump may be damaged.

Method for using the measuring cup
The measuring cup is on the backside of the
chemical tank lid. (The measuring cup is
detachable from the chemical tanklid.)
To keep the solution from contamination, be
sure to dissolve the chemical in another
container and filter the solution with the strainer
before pouring it into the chemical tank.
How to remove the strainer
Set the ribs on the both side of the inner strainer
horizontal or vertical to the chemical tank to
remove the strainer.
With the ribs on the both sides of the inner strainer
horizontal or vertical to the chemical tank, turn the
ribs by 45 degrees to semifix the strainer to the
chemical tank. Doing so prevents the strainer from
rising when using foaming chemicals.
